Transaction 9def1e68fa324a25a341ddc7940a4ecfbd1da10a0f26ec1424372347d3576594
1 Input
2 Outputs
- 9def1e68fa324a25a341ddc7940a4ecfbd1da10a0f26ec1424372347d3576594:0
- 9def1e68fa324a25a341ddc7940a4ecfbd1da10a0f26ec1424372347d3576594:1
value 2262227991
address 17QoBjw8bJCYvJBFAcEtP65tfXuMJNHzc
value 53577807
address 1A8ZY3iSS2aFGPcu3oAuc7QR3ag8ajg85z